Smudging Ceremony


Consider performing a simple smudging ceremony to start incorporating sage:


  1. Gather Your Materials: You need a bundle of dried sage, a fireproof container, and matches or a lighter.


  2. Set Intention: Before lighting the sage, set a clear intention for your smudging, whether it be for protection or purification.


  3. Light the Sage: Carefully ignite one end of the sage bundle until it catches fire, then blow it out to let it smolder.


  4. Smudge the Space: Walk around your area, allowing the smoke to fill corners and cleanse objects needing purification.


  5. Extinguish Safely: When finished, place the sage bundle in the fireproof container to extinguish it.
